Police are appealing for help to identify a man in connection with the theft of takings from a taxi in Plymouth.
A spokesperson for Cornwall and Devon Police said officers are investigating a report that a vehicle window was smashed overnight between 9 January and 10 January in Stonehouse Street. Around £170 in cash was stolen from the taxi.
Enquiries remain ongoing and investigating officers are seeking to identify a man pictured on a bicycle in the area at the time. Police believe he may be able to assist with their enquiries.
The incident has raised concerns among drivers about vehicle security and the risks associated with leaving takings inside vehicles, even for short periods. Officers are urging anyone who recognises the man in the image or who has information about the incident to come forward.
